Question
I awoke the other morning hearing the horn sounding on my daughters Galant. It was cold that morning into the teens. The only thing I thought of was to unplug the horns. She took it to Advance Auto, The man plugged the horns back in only to sound off again. He also said the horn relay was hot so he pulled it out. It has to be the security system or the horn contacts. How can I check the horn contacts without setting off the air bags?

Answer
Charles: You need to take that car to a shop, as there is a short in it. If the relay for the horn was hot, there is switch that is staying closed and so setting off the horn. It would be better if you took it to a shop or dealership just because of those air bags sensors. As they will have to find that short or the switch then fix it. They would know what they are doing. It could be the horn or it could be something has shortened into the horn wires. Again it is best for a shop to check this over for you. God bless; Linda
